
MySQL,作为一款开源的关系型数据库管理系统,凭借其高性能、可靠性和易用性,在全球范围内赢得了广泛的认可和应用
尽管Windows Server 2003(以下简称Win2003)作为一款较老的服务器操作系统,但在许多企业的IT架构中依然扮演着重要角色
本文将详细介绍如何在Win2003环境下下载并安装MySQL,以及如何通过一系列配置优化,打造高效的数据管理系统
一、为何选择MySQL? 在探讨如何在Win2003上安装MySQL之前,我们先来了解一下MySQL为何成为众多企业的首选
1.开源免费:MySQL采用GPL(GNU通用公共许可证)发布,这意味着用户可以免费获取源代码,并根据自身需求进行修改和分发,极大地降低了企业的IT成本
2.高性能:MySQL经过多年优化,能够在各种硬件配置上提供高效的数据处理能力,特别适用于Web应用、数据仓库等场景
3.兼容性:MySQL支持多种编程语言,如PHP、Python、Java等,便于与现有系统集成
4.社区支持:拥有一个庞大的开源社区,提供丰富的文档、插件和解决方案,帮助用户快速解决问题
5.安全性:通过权限管理、数据加密等手段,确保数据安全,满足多数企业的安全需求
二、Windows 2003环境下的MySQL下载 虽然Win2003已不是最新的操作系统,但MySQL社区仍然提供了与之兼容的版本
以下是下载步骤: 1.访问MySQL官方网站: 打开浏览器,访问【MySQL官方网站】(https://dev.mysql.com/downloads/mysql/),这是获取官方MySQL软件包的唯一可靠来源
2.选择下载版本: 在下载页面,根据操作系统类型选择“Windows(x86, 32-bit)”或“Windows(x86, 64-bit)”,尽管Win2003主要支持32位系统
注意,由于Win2003较老,建议下载MySQL的旧版本,通常MySQL 5.x系列中的早期版本会提供对Win2003的支持
3.安装包类型: 对于大多数用户,选择“MySQL Installer for Windows”是较为方便的选择,它包含了MySQL Server、MySQL Workbench等多种工具
但如果仅需要MySQL Server,可以选择单独的MSI安装包
4.下载并保存: 点击下载链接后,根据提示保存安装包至本地磁盘
建议使用默认设置,便于后续安装
三、MySQL在Windows 2003上的安装 下载完成后,接下来是安装步骤: 1.运行安装包: 双击下载的安装包,启动安装向导
如果是MySQL Installer,则先选择“Custom”或“Developer Default”安装类型,以便选择需要安装的组件
2.接受许可协议: 阅读并接受MySQL的许可协议,继续下一步
3.选择安装路径: 建议保持默认安装路径,除非有特殊需求
同时,注意安装路径中不应包含空格或特殊字符,以避免潜在问题
4.配置MySQL Server: 安装过程中,会出现配置MySQL Server的界面
这里需要设置MySQL的root密码、选择配置类型(如Development Machine、Server Machine等),以及配置InnoDB等存储引擎的相关参数
根据服务器性能和预期负载,选择合适的配置类型
5.应用配置并安装: 完成上述设置后,点击“Execute”开始安装过程
安装完成后,MySQL服务将自动启动
四、MySQL配置与优化 安装完成后,为确保MySQL在Win2003上高效运行,还需进行一些基本配置和优化: 1.调整内存分配: Win2003的内存资源有限,因此需要根据实际情况调整MySQL的内存使用
可以通过修改`my.ini`(MySQL配置文件)中的`innodb_buffer_pool_size`、`key_buffer_size`等参数,合理分配内存资源
2.优化存储引擎: InnoDB是MySQL默认的存储引擎,支持事务处理和外键约束
根据应用需求,选择合适的存储引擎,并调整相关参数,如日志文件大小、刷新频率等
3.安全设置: 修改root密码,创建必要的数据库用户,并赋予最小权限原则,增强系统安全性
同时,启用防火墙规则,限制对MySQL端口的访问
4.备份与恢复: 定期备份数据库,以防数据丢失
MySQL提供了多种备份方式,如mysqldump、xtrabackup等,根据数据量和备份需求选择合适的方法
5.监控与调优: 使用MySQL自带的性能监控工具(如SHOW STATUS、SHOW VARIABLES)或第三方工具(如Percona Monitoring and Management),监控数据库性能,及时发现并解决瓶颈问题
五、总结 尽管Windows Server 2003已逐渐退出历史舞台,但在许多企业的IT环境中,它依然承担着重要的角色
通过在Win2003上安装并配置MySQL,企业可以继续利用这一成熟稳定的数据库管理系统,支持关键业务应用
本文详细介绍了MySQL在Win2003环境下的下载、安装及优化步骤,旨在帮助企业高效管理数据,提升业务处理能力
随着技术的不断进步,建议企业逐步规划向更现代的操作系统和数据库平台迁移,以享受最新的技术红利和安全性保障
解决MySQL连接失败问题:排查与修复指南
Windows 2003系统MySQL安装包下载指南
MySQL技巧:如何更新部分数据
MySQL中英文混合排序技巧
一键更新MySQL多库行数据技巧
MySQL常用SQL语句速览指南
MySQL底层配置自动化同步:提升数据库管理效率的秘密武器
CentOS系统下MySQL备份实用命令
MySQL监控报警系统全解析
Win7系统下MySQL数据库安装教程
CentOS系统下快速连接MySQL指南
Win 7系统下轻松启动MySQL数据库教程
MySQL配置指南:轻松管理MC点券系统
MySQL宿舍管理系统答辩热点问答
CentOS系统下MySQL GZ安装包下载指南
Ubuntu系统下轻松修改MySQL密码指南
Windows系统下连接MySQL教程
Win系统下MySQL静态编译指南
全面指南:如何彻底删除MySQL数据库管理系统